Handover: charset sniffing in Textgrove

Hey Marek — before you review the branch, some context. Textgrove's encoding detection for uploaded text files now runs a two-pass sniff: byte-order marks first, then a statistical pass using the Ferndale tables. The old heuristic mislabeled Turkish and Czech files constantly, hence the rewrite. Mixed-encoding files fall back to a configurable default rather than erroring. The detector reads its thresholds from the settings pasted below.

config for kaguf-tahop:
fenir:
  pin: 0174
  tenant: novix
  seal: seal_58ebeb9f
  metrics_host: metrics.fenir.halixsoft.corp
  standby_team: gilys
  escalation: weniel-feniel
  nonce: 50fe55

## Session handling in Tillworth integration tests

The flakiness mostly comes from sessions expiring mid-suite: Tillworth's payment sandbox caps sessions at 10 minutes, and our slower CI runners blow past that. Fix is to refresh the session in a per-class setup hook rather than once globally. The refresh call against the sandbox authenticates with the bearer token below.

login token, bagug-kafop: eyJhbGciOiJIUzI1NiIsInR5cCI6IkpXVCJ9.eyJzdWIiOiIcMLov2In0.Z5RLDIfp

**Key Ceremony Checklist — Item 7: Configure log sampling for the Chirrup relay**

Plugin authors: the Chirrup relay emits extremely high-volume debug logs, so before signing your plugin manifest, set sampling to one-in-fifty for info-level events and keep errors unsampled. Verify the sampler config hash matches the ceremony record exactly. Then unlock the ceremony signing drawer, which requires the recovery passphrase below.

recovery phrase for kahof-hawif: holok-julvan-eliax-ulaath-briath

### Soft Deletes — orders table

In the Lanternmere commerce stack, rows in `orders` are never hard-deleted; the `retired_at` column is set and a tombstone event is emitted to the Driftgate audit bus. Reviewers verifying purge compliance should query the reconciliation endpoint, which only accepts authenticated requests. The service credential used for those audit queries appears directly below this section.

gateway credential: kto11_pTkcHgLwuNE